Eligibility Criteria for Ph.D. in Instrumentation Engineering at Gauhati University

  • Master’s degree (M.Tech, M.Sc, or equivalent) in Instrumentation Engineering, Electrical Engineering, Electronics & Communication, or a closely related discipline with a minimum of 55% aggregate (or CGPA 6.0/10).
  • Qualified in a recognized national-level entrance test (GATE, CSIR‑UGC NET, or university‑specific test) OR a minimum of 7.0 GPA in the qualifying master’s program.
  • Candidates with a B.Tech/M.Tech in a relevant field and a valid research proposal may be considered under the “Direct Entry” scheme.
  • Minimum age limit: 30 years for general category; relaxation of up to 5 years for SC/ST/PH categories.

Entrance Exam for Ph.D. in Instrumentation Engineering at Gauhati University

The university conducts its own entrance examination, called the GU Ph.D. Entrance Test (GUPET). The test evaluates:

  • Core knowledge of instrumentation and control theory.
  • Mathematical aptitude and signal processing.
  • Research methodology and analytical writing skills.

Candidates who hold valid GATE or CSIR‑NET scores are exempted from GUPET and may directly apply for the interview stage.

Fee Structure for Ph.D. in Instrumentation Engineering at Gauhati University

Component Amount (INR) Notes
Application Fee (online) 1,500 Non‑refundable, payable at submission
Admission Fee (once per semester) 4,000 Includes lab usage charges
Annual Tuition & Research Fee 22,000 Payable in two installments (Jan & July)
Library & Resource Access 1,200 Includes e‑journal subscriptions
Miscellaneous (printing, certification) 800 Estimated per year
Total Approx. per Year 29,500  

Scholarships, fellowships, and research assistantships can significantly reduce the financial burden.

Admission Process for Ph.D. in Instrumentation Engineering at Gauhati University

  1. Online registration on the university’s Ph.D. Admissions Portal.
  2. Upload scanned copies of academic certificates, scorecards, and a research proposal (max 1500 words).
  3. Pay the non‑refundable application fee.
  4. Appear for GUPET or submit qualified GATE/NET scores.
  5. Shortlisted candidates are invited for a personal interview and presentation of the research proposal.
  6. Final admission letter is issued after verification of documents and payment of the admission fee.

Gauhati University Ph.D. Syllabus for Instrumentation Engineering

The syllabus is divided into two phases:

  1. Coursework (Year 1) – Core modules such as Advanced Control Theory, Digital Signal Processing, Research Methodology, and Electives aligned with the chosen specialization.
  2. Research Phase (Year 2‑4) – Comprehensive literature review, experimental design, data collection, thesis writing, and publication of at least two peer‑reviewed papers.

Scholarship for Ph.D. in Instrumentation Engineering at Gauhati University

Financial assistance options include:

  • University Merit Scholarship (up to 100% tuition waiver for top 10% candidates).
  • AICTE Doctoral Fellowship (₹15,000 per month for 2 years).
  • UGC Junior Research Fellowship (₹31,000 per month) for eligible candidates.
  • Project‑based assistantships – funded by industry partners or government research grants.

FAQs Regarding Ph.D. in Instrumentation Engineering at Gauhati University

What is the minimum duration of the Ph.D. program?
The minimum period is 3 years, extendable up to 5 years based on research progress.
Can I pursue the Ph.D. part‑time while working?
Yes, the university offers a part‑time mode for professionals, provided they meet the minimum credit requirements and attend mandatory seminars.
